Is this Normal? 4 Season Ending Injuries in 13 Days
I don't know what's going on, but there have been 4 season ending injuries in the first 13 days of the season. I always adjust the injury database to lower the number of injury days because I only play an 80 game season. I also double-checked this and it is identical to what I used in OOTP16 (basically, I cut the injury days by 30%).
Has something changed, am I missing something, or is this just random? |

Lowering all the injury durations in the injury database by 30% will not lower the duration of all your injuries by 30%. With the way the injury db works, there's no way to get that result. You've probably only prevented the absolute longest injuries from ever occurring with your injury db edits. Otherwise, you'll have the same number and duration of short injuries (under 9 months anyway) as anyone else).
